On 1/21/2023 at 1:14 AM, Frisco Larson said:

I HAVE seen some before, but I can't remember any specifics. In fact, I may be mistaken, but I think there was some discussion if Mile High ll should be a pedigree or not. My memory may be off on that. Perhaps someone else knows about what I recall. It's actually NOT listed as a pedigree in the CGC pedigree list, which is weird because this is obviously a newest generation label, so I don't know why it wouldn't be listed as a pedigree.  (shrug)

MH2 is not a pedigree, it's a warehouse find that Chuck R. marketed. It's on the label because Chuck paid for that designation. Think of it as the "FROM THE COLLECTION OF" notations you will see on certain books like Dallas Stephens (another Chuck R. offering) or Nic Cage
